1.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Which persuasive appeal aims to evoke emotions and feelings in the audience?
Pathetic appeal
Pathos appeal
Logos appeal
Ethos appeal
Answer explanation
Pathos appeal aims to evoke emotions and feelings in the audience. It uses emotional language and storytelling to persuade.

2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
What is the persuasive appeal that relies on the credibility and expertise of the speaker?
pathos
ethos
mythos
logos
Answer explanation
Ethos is the persuasive appeal that relies on the credibility and expertise of the speaker. It establishes trust and credibility with the audience.

3.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Which persuasive appeal uses evidence and facts to support the argument?
Appeal to emotion
Appeal to pathos
Appeal to logos
Appeal to ethos
Answer explanation
The persuasive appeal that uses evidence and facts to support the argument is 'Appeal to logos'. It relies on logical reasoning and factual evidence to convince the audience.
